Transaction 59a69359b059bf12b5ab00f475c56dc1d58558bdec18de42624f5b7fd18254de
1 Input
1 Output
-
59a69359b059bf12b5ab00f475c56dc1d58558bdec18de42624f5b7fd18254de:0
- value
- 1993932
- script pubkey
- OP_0 OP_PUSHBYTES_20 c06510789c1d6ac84a1a50854b8e85eea26283ed
- address
- bc1qcpj3q7yur44vsjs62zz5hr59a63x9qldcuzhhz